Search prompting method and system

A technology for searching prompts and prompt words, which is applied in the fields of instruments, computing, and electrical and digital data processing, and can solve problems such as inaccurate options of prompt information.

Active Publication Date: 2013-07-03
NEW FOUNDER HLDG DEV LLC +2
View PDF4 Cites 7 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] The embodiment of the present application provides a search prompt method and system, which is used to solv...

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Search prompting method and system
  • Search prompting method and system
  • Search prompting method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0052] Such as figure 1 As shown, Embodiment 1 of the present application provides a method for constructing a prompt dictionary, which specifically includes:

[0053] Step 101, based on the original dictionary, generate the original double-array dictionary through the double-array algorithm;

[0054] Step 102, generating a search prompt dictionary based on the original double array dictionary; and / or

[0055] Step 103, generate a spelling error prompt dictionary based on the original double-array dictionary.

[0056] For step 101, based on the original dictionary, the original double-array dictionary is generated through the double-array algorithm, and the construction process is as follows:

[0057] First traverse the entire dictionary to convert all words into a Trie tree (dictionary tree) in bytes.

[0058] Then build a double array. The construction process mainly has the following steps:

[0059] 1. Initialize the list of active nodes, and add the first-level nodes t...

Embodiment 2

[0103] Such as Figure 4 As shown, Embodiment 2 of the present application provides a search prompt method, which specifically includes:

[0104] Step 201, obtaining the search information input by the user;

[0105] Step 202, judging whether the search information is legal;

[0106] Step 203, when the search information is legal, based on the generated search prompt dictionary, and return the search prompt words corresponding to the search information;

[0107] Step 204, when the search information is invalid, prompt a dictionary based on the generated spelling error, and return at least two pieces of error prompt information corresponding to the search information.

[0108] The methods for generating the search prompt dictionary and the misspelling prompt dictionary have been introduced in Embodiment 1, and will not be repeated here.

Embodiment 3

[0110] Such as Figure 5 As shown, Embodiment 3 of the present application provides a search prompt system, which is characterized in that it includes:

[0111] Obtaining unit 301, configured to obtain search information input by the user;

[0112] A judging unit 302, configured to judge whether the search information is legal;

[0113] A search prompt word returning unit 303, configured to return a search prompt word corresponding to the search information based on the generated search prompt dictionary when the search information is legal;

[0114] The error prompt information returning unit 304 is configured to prompt a dictionary based on the generated spelling error when the search information is invalid, and return at least two pieces of error prompt information corresponding to the search information.

[0115] Likewise, the methods for generating the search prompt dictionary and the misspelling prompt dictionary have been introduced in Embodiment 1, and will not be re...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a search prompting method and system. The search prompting method comprises the following steps: acquiring search information inputted by users; judging whether the search information is legal or not; when the search information is legal, returning a search prompting word corresponding to the search information on the basis of the generated search prompting dictionary; and when the search information is illegal, returning at least two pieces of error prompting information corresponding to the search information on the basis of the generated spelling mistake prompting dictionary. Due to the adoption of the scheme, the prompting dictionary is constructed by double arrays and when prompt inquiry is searched, the inquiry efficiency is increased and the problems that search prompting information and spelling mistake prompting information is inaccurate or options are fewer in the prior art are solved.

Description

technical field [0001] The invention relates to the technical field of computer internet, in particular to a search prompt method and system. Background technique [0002] With the rapid development of the Internet in the world, network media has been recognized as the "fourth media" after newspapers, radio and television, and the network has become an indispensable part of people's daily life, study and work. Network information disseminates rapidly and has the characteristics of massive data. What users urgently need is how to quickly retrieve useful information from this massive data. [0003] User input prompts are also called search box prompts, which give corresponding complete information prompts through users inputting part of the query information in the search box. It is an auxiliary user experience tool, which saves users a lot of input costs and improves retrieval efficiency. [0004] During the invention process, the inventor found that the current search prom...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F17/30
Inventor 刘志超于晓明杨建武
Owner NEW FOUNDER HLDG DEV L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products